    I can't decide. I'm a huge Starling fan who thinks, on one hand, that Marlon absolutely befuddles Ike with his defense and counter punches his way to an easy victory.

    On the other hand, a good jab is always a great defense killer and there are few jabs at 140-147 pounds as strong as Quartey's was.

    Most of the guys who gave Marlon trouble, starting with the jab, were taller than him. Guys like Curry, Blocker and even Breland had success against Marlon because of their height, reach and long jabs.

    I see this fight going 12 with Marlon losing a MD that would be highly disputed.
